# SLIP OR FALL OF PERSON
> MSHA accident `220140130025` · 01/06/2014 · Consol Pennsylvania Coal Company LLC
## Details
- **Degree of injury:** DAYS AWAY FROM WORK ONLY
- **Classification:** SLIP OR FALL OF PERSON
- **Accident type:** Caught in, under or between NEC
- **Occupation:** Laborer, Bull gang,  Parts runner, Roustabout, Roof trimmer/scaler
- **Activity:** Lay or repair railroad track
- **Injury source:** STEEL RAIL (ALL KINDS)
- **Nature of injury:** FRACTURE,CHIP
- **Body part:** ANKLE
- **Days lost:** 357
- **Mine experience:** 0.58 years
## Operator
- **Controller:** CONSOL Energy Inc
- **Operator:** Consol Pennsylvania Coal Company LLC
- **Mine:** [3610045](https://api.ai-analytics.org/mine/3610045)
## Narrative

employee was in the process of laying track when he took a step backward and his right foot was under the rail, he fell backward and injured the outside of his right ankle. (fracture)
